Output fba8b850db3c8b75ec510b28d1f59a3c144eb3589ffd5446cea4ce2b4e56f4c6:0

value
8455685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e46426c7097c719388e4a90da71a248bdda39dd0 OP_EQUAL
address
3NWdxvkUxmBRnRLVFkAoniVYr9BVEXcmuy
transaction
fba8b850db3c8b75ec510b28d1f59a3c144eb3589ffd5446cea4ce2b4e56f4c6
spent
true